Enhanced optooptical light deflection using cavity resonance

Not Accessible

Your library or personal account may give you access

Abstract

The efficiency of optooptical light deflection by nondegenerate four-wave mixing can be increased significantly by placing the grating in a resonant cavity. Theory and experiment are presented for linear and ring cavities. Efficiency improvement by an order of magnitude is predicted, and improvements by a factor of 5.6 have been demonstrated.
